About This Position

Purpose of Position:
Provide administrative secretarial support and perform clerical work for the Planning and Zoning Department.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
The following duties are normal for this position. These are not to be construed as exclusive or all-inclusive. Other
duties may be required and assigned.
  • Performing bookkeeping/financial activities associated with administrative support duties including maintaining expense/revenue ledgers for the department.
  • Performing preliminary review of permits and applications submitted to the department for errors, omissions and accuracy.
  • Verifying legal descriptions and interpreting legal descriptions based on the Public Land Survey System.
  • Researching property ownership through software.
  • Researching ownership of parcels using register of deeds documents.
  • Manage revenue accounts, voucher payments, and petty cash fund.
  • Performs data entry and generates periodic reports for sanitary permit and maintenance records.
  • Organize information, files and records based on name, legal description, address, and/or parcel identification number.
  • Contributing to the processing and documentation of rural emergency addresses with other department employees.
  • Attend meetings and hearings and record minutes of proceedings.
  • Draft legal notices meeting the statutory requirements for public information meetings etc.
  • Makes appointments for department head and other staff. Arranges meetings and conferences.
  • Performs other administrative/clerical tasks such photocopying, opening and distributing mail, compiling documents and information for presentations.
  • Inventory and requisition office supplies.
  • Design forms, newsletters, brochures and other department documents.
  • Create scaled maps for customers using the GIS webpage.
  • Explain use of county GIS webpage to users.
  • Must have typing ability of at least 50 words per minute.
  • Communicating with the general public and staff members in general ordinance administration under the direction and guidance of the department administrator.
  • Attends meetings, conferences, seminars, and educational training as required by the department administrator

Minimum Training and Experience Required to Perform Essential Job Functions
A Technical Diploma or Certificate from an accredited post-secondary institution and a minimum of two years’ administrative support experience is required. In evaluating candidates for this position, the County may consider a combination of education, training and experience which provides the necessary knowledge, skills and abilities to
perform the duties of the position.
